First day of testing this week for Scuderia Ferrari Marlboro, working at the Paul Ricard-HTTT Le Castellet circuit, in the South of France.
Felipe Massa and Marc Gene were in action today, both at the wheel of a 248 F1. The work schedule, which took place on the 2A-b-SC version of the track, revolved mainly around Bridgestone tyre development for the next three races, which take place in Germany, Hungary and Turkey.
In addition, the two drivers also worked on development of mechanical and electrical solutions. The summary of the day in numbers is: 92 laps for Felipe (best time 59”627) and 180 for Marc (1’00”080.).
Testing continues at this circuit tomorrow, with Felipe Massa and Michael Schumacher on track.
